AI Technical Summary

Technical Problem

In existing technologies, pulverized coal silos operate under high positive pressure for extended periods, resulting in high exhaust loads on the silo top filter bags, easy damage, low feeding efficiency, and easy pulverized coal spillage causing environmental pollution.

Method used

The system uses a weight sensor and a pressure relief device combined with control components to monitor the coal powder inventory and air pressure in the coal powder silo in real time. The air pressure is adjusted by the pressure relief device to maintain a negative pressure state in the coal powder silo and avoid high-pressure operation.

Benefits of technology

It effectively reduces the air pressure load on the pulverized coal silo, reduces the risk of filter bag damage, improves feeding efficiency, prevents pulverized coal from scattering, and ensures stable system operation.

Abstract

本发明提供一种提升煤粉仓排气效率的系统和方法,包括煤粉仓;喷吹罐,喷吹罐与煤粉仓连通,煤粉仓输入煤粉进入喷吹罐,喷吹罐与煤粉仓之间还通过泄压阀连通,喷吹罐通过泄压阀卸除压力至煤粉仓内;重量传感器与煤粉仓连接用于检测煤粉仓内部的煤粉存量;泄压装置,泄压装置与煤粉仓连通用于调节煤粉仓的气压;控制组件与泄压阀、重量传感器和泄压装置连接;本发明中的技术方案带来的有益效果至少包括:设置重量传感器、泄压阀和控制系统,能实时的掌控煤粉仓内部的气压值,通过与煤粉仓连通的泄压装置对煤粉仓进行泄压操作,降低煤粉仓内的气压值,便于将煤粉输入到煤粉仓内,同时降低煤粉仓的气压值也能避免排气负荷过大。
